SALT LAKE CITY — The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ints announced Friday morning that it would create 55 new missions across the world.
“At a time when increasing numbers of young members of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ints continue to choose to serve full-time missions, the Church is announcing plans to create an additional 55 missions, effective July 1, 2026,” the church said.
The new additions will bring the total number of missions to 506 worldwide.
“The new missions will help to accommodate a growing number of missionaries already called and will allow missionaries to better support the increasing number of congregations throughout the world,” the church said.
